* gre: Generic Routing Encapsulation package supportSteven Barth2014-07-302-0/+299
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The package supports Generic Routing Encapsulation support by registering following protocol kinds: -gre -gretap -grev6 -grev6tap Following options are valid for gre and gretap kinds: -ipaddr -peeraddr -df -mtu -ttl -tunlink -zone -ikey -okey -icsum -ocsum -iseqno -oseqno The gretap kind supports additionally the network option Following options are valid for grev6 and grev6tap kinds: -ip6addr -peer6addr -weakif -mtu -ttl -tunlink -zone -ikey -okey -icsum -ocsum -iseqno -oseqno The grev6tap kind supports additionally the network option Typical network config for a GREv4 tunnel : config interface 'gre' option peeraddr '172.16.18.240' option mtu '1400' option proto 'gre' option tunlink 'wan' option zone 'tunnel' Typical network config for a GREv4 tap tunnel : config interface 'gretap' option peeraddr '195.207.5.79' option mtu '1400' option proto 'gretap' option zone 'tunnel' option tunlink 'wan' option network 'wlan_ap' I added myself as maintainer for the moment; feel free to change.
